2. File Codecs
The viability of using a particular audio clip as a cellular system alert hinges considerably on its file format. Compatibility between the audio file kind and the system’s working system dictates whether or not the sound may be efficiently applied. Discrepancies in file format assist can render the specified sound unusable, necessitating format conversion or various acquisition strategies.
-
MP3 (MPEG Audio Layer III)
MP3 is a ubiquitous lossy audio format extensively supported throughout quite a few units and platforms. Its excessive compression ratio ends in comparatively small file sizes, excellent for cellular use the place space for storing is usually a constraint. The prevalence of MP3 ensures broad compatibility, making it a sensible selection for alert sounds. Nevertheless, the lossy compression sacrifices some audio constancy in comparison with lossless codecs.
-
M4R (MPEG 4 Audio)
M4R is a proprietary audio format developed by Apple, primarily related to iOS units. It’s particularly designed to be used as alert sounds and ringtones on iPhones. Whereas technically based mostly on the AAC (Superior Audio Coding) format, M4R information have particular metadata embedded, signaling to the iOS working system that they’re meant for ringtone use. This specialization gives seamless integration throughout the Apple ecosystem.
-
WAV (Waveform Audio File Format)
WAV is a lossless audio format that preserves the total audio constancy of the unique recording. This lack of compression ends in considerably bigger file sizes in comparison with MP3 or M4R. Whereas WAV gives superior audio high quality, its massive file dimension typically makes it impractical for cellular system use, significantly on units with restricted storage. WAV format assist can even fluctuate throughout completely different cellular working programs.
-
OGG (Ogg Vorbis)
OGG Vorbis is a free and open-source lossy audio format. Whereas providing comparable compression effectivity and audio high quality to MP3, its adoption is much less widespread. Help for OGG Vorbis varies throughout cellular units. On Android units, native assist is out there; nevertheless, iOS units require third-party purposes for playback and utilization. This lowered compatibility limits its practicality.
The number of an applicable audio file format is essential for efficiently integrating a most popular alert sound right into a cellular system. The interaction between file dimension, audio high quality, system compatibility, and platform assist determines the optimum selection. Within the context of acquiring a specific melody, customers should contemplate these components to make sure seamless integration and optimum efficiency.

4. System Compatibility
The flexibility to efficiently make the most of a particular audio clip, akin to the long-lasting ringtone, on a goal system is basically predicated on compatibility. This encompasses the interaction between the audio file’s format, the system’s working system, and any proprietary restrictions imposed by the producer. System compatibility represents a important gatekeeper, figuring out whether or not the acquisition and subsequent implementation of the audio file may be achieved.
-
Working System Help
Completely different cellular working programs exhibit various levels of assist for numerous audio codecs. iOS, for instance, historically favors the M4R format for ringtones, whereas Android gives broader assist for MP3, OGG, and WAV information. The working system’s native capabilities dictate whether or not the system can acknowledge, decode, and make the most of a given audio file as an alert sound. Trying to make use of an incompatible format necessitates format conversion, which may introduce complexities and potential high quality degradation. The underlying working system structure dictates format compatibility, requiring particular codecs for audio decoding and playback. Units with out the requisite codecs are unable to course of the audio file, thus hindering performance.
-
Codec Availability
Codecs are software program elements liable for encoding and decoding audio information. A tool’s means to play a particular audio file hinges on the presence of the corresponding codec. Some audio codecs, significantly these using superior compression methods, require specialised codecs not universally included in all units. Lack of the suitable codec necessitates the set up of third-party software program or format conversion. The inclusion of particular codecs is commonly dictated by licensing agreements and producer preferences. This variance in codec availability contributes to the fragmentation of system compatibility throughout completely different producers and working system variations. Legacy units might lack assist for newer codecs, limiting their means to play modern audio codecs.

6. Set up Course of
The process for implementing a downloaded audio file as a tool’s designated alert sign is a important step following its acquisition. The set up course of dictates the usability of the downloaded asset and varies considerably relying on the system’s working system and manufacturer-specific customizations. Efficiently navigating this course of is important for personalizing a cellular system with a most popular sound.
-
File Switch Strategies
The preliminary stage typically includes transferring the downloaded audio file from a pc to the goal cellular system. This may be completed by way of a number of strategies, together with USB connection, cloud storage companies, or wi-fi file switch protocols akin to Bluetooth. The chosen technique have to be suitable with each the pc and the cellular system. For instance, transferring an M4R file to an iPhone usually requires iTunes or Finder, whereas transferring an MP3 file to an Android system may be performed through USB drag-and-drop. The file switch technique impacts the pace and comfort of the set up course of.
-
System Settings Navigation
As soon as the audio file resides on the cellular system, the following step includes navigating the system’s system settings to find the sound customization choices. This usually includes accessing the “Sounds,” “Notifications,” or “Personalization” sections throughout the settings menu. The particular terminology and menu construction can fluctuate relying on the system’s working system and producer pores and skin. For example, on Android units, customers usually navigate to “Settings” > “Sound” > “Ringtone,” whereas on iOS, the trail is “Settings” > “Sounds & Haptics” > “Ringtone.” Understanding the system’s person interface is important for efficiently finding the related settings.
-
Format Compatibility and Conversion
Previous to trying set up, confirming the audio file’s format compatibility with the system’s working system is important. As beforehand famous, iOS units primarily make the most of the M4R format for ringtones, whereas Android units typically assist MP3. If the downloaded file is in an incompatible format, conversion is important. On-line audio converters or desktop software program can be utilized to transform the file to a suitable format. For instance, changing an MP3 file to M4R for iPhone use ensures compatibility. The format conversion course of ought to keep acceptable audio high quality to make sure a passable expertise.
-
Ringtone Size Limitations
Many cellular units impose limitations on the utmost size of customized ringtones. If the downloaded audio file exceeds this restrict, it have to be trimmed or edited to adapt to the system’s restrictions. Audio modifying software program or on-line instruments can be utilized to shorten the audio file to an appropriate size. For instance, iOS units historically restricted ringtone size to 30 seconds, requiring customers to truncate longer audio information. Adhering to ringtone size limitations ensures compatibility and correct playback.

7. Audio High quality
The constancy of the sound replica related to the precise audio file is a important issue influencing the person expertise. Whereas accessibility, file format, and compatibility issues are paramount, the perceived readability and richness of the reproduced sound considerably contribute to person satisfaction. The acquisition of a low-quality audio file, no matter its ease of obtain or format compatibility, diminishes the meant influence and nostalgic attraction of the chosen auditory alert.
-
Sampling Price and Bit Depth
The sampling fee, measured in Hertz (Hz), defines the variety of audio samples taken per second through the digitization course of. A better sampling fee captures extra element, leading to a extra correct illustration of the unique sound. Equally, bit depth determines the variety of bits used to symbolize every pattern, with greater bit depths offering better dynamic vary and decrease quantization noise. A decrease sampling fee or bit depth will lead to a demonstrably poorer audio high quality, characterised by a scarcity of high-frequency element and elevated audible noise. Within the particular audio file’s context, a decrease high quality supply file with decrease specs would sound notably degraded in comparison with the unique composition.
-
Compression Artifacts
Lossy audio compression methods, akin to these employed by MP3 and AAC (utilized in M4R), cut back file dimension by discarding audio information deemed perceptually irrelevant. Whereas environment friendly for storage and transmission, aggressive compression can introduce audible artifacts, akin to pre-echoes, distortion, and a “smearing” of transient sounds. The extent of compression instantly impacts the severity of those artifacts. Within the context of acquiring a available file, a extremely compressed model will exhibit noticeable distortion and lowered readability in comparison with a model encoded at a better bitrate. That is significantly noticeable within the high-frequency elements and transient sounds prevalent within the melody.
